当前时区为 UTC + 8 小时



发表新帖 回复这个主题  [ 2 篇帖子 ] 
作者 内容
1 楼 
 文章标题 : 虚拟机共享ADSL上网求助
帖子发表于 : 2009-06-10 18:21 

注册: 2006-09-08 18:57
帖子: 115
送出感谢: 0 次
接收感谢: 2
我原来用ADSL modem开路由上网,使用桥接方式,按照论坛上的方法,建立了tap0,tap1,tap2,br0等等。host和guest全都在同一网段。
代码:
ADSL modem :192.168.1.1
host : 192.168.1.2
br0 : 192.168.1.3
tap0 : 192.168.1.4
tap1 : 192.168.1.5

依此类推。
所有机器的网关设为192.168.1.1
本来一直上网正常,但是后来我发觉ADSL Modem的质量不行,开路由影响网速,特别容易断流。于是就改成了手工拨号,结果guest就不能正常上网了。这是我的interfaces:
代码:
auto lo
iface lo inet loopback

auto eth0
iface eth0 inet static
address 192.168.1.2
netmask 255.255.255.0

auto tap0
iface tap0 inet manual
up ifconfig $IFACE 0.0.0.0 up
down ifconfig $IFACE down
tunctl_user rikhtdss

auto tap1
iface tap1 inet manual
up ifconfig $IFACE 0.0.0.0 up
down ifconfig $IFACE down
tunctl_user rikhtdss

auto tap2
iface tap2 inet manual
up ifconfig $IFACE 0.0.0.0 up
down ifconfig $IFACE down
tunctl_user rikhtdss

auto br0
iface br0 inet static
bridge_ports eth0 tap0 tap1 tap2
address 192.168.1.3
netmask 255.255.255.0
network 192.168.1.1
broadcast 192.168.1.255

auto dsl-provider
iface dsl-provider inet ppp
pre-up /sbin/ifconfig br0 up # line maintained by pppoeconf
provider dsl-provider


考虑到原来是由ADSL Modem做NAT地址转换,现在ADSL Modem改成了纯桥接,需要我的Host来充当NAT的角色,于是就百度了一些资料照着做,结果还是一头雾水。

现在我运行:
代码:
sudo echo 1 > /proc/sys/net/ipv4/ip_forward
sudo iptables -t nat -A POSTROUTING -j MASQUERADE

没有报错,Guest 机器ping 192.168.1.3 可通,将网关设为该地址却无法上网。不知道什么地方做错了。


页首
 用户资料  
 
2 楼 
 文章标题 : Re: 虚拟机共享ADSL上网求助
帖子发表于 : 2009-06-13 19:13 

注册: 2009-06-13 19:06
帖子: 3
送出感谢: 0 次
接收感谢: 0 次
把手工拨号那台主机设为网关,即可实现Guest同时上网。
我在Debian上试过了,完全没问题。楼主是不是哪里设置有问题。

可以参考我的Blog:
http://www.celon.net.cn/


页首
 用户资料  
 
显示帖子 :  排序  
发表新帖 回复这个主题  [ 2 篇帖子 ] 

当前时区为 UTC + 8 小时


在线用户

正在浏览此版面的用户:没有注册用户 和 3 位游客


不能 在这个版面发表主题
不能 在这个版面回复主题
不能 在这个版面编辑帖子
不能 在这个版面删除帖子
不能 在这个版面提交附件

前往 :  
本站点为公益性站点,用于推广开源自由软件,由 DiaHosting VPSBudgetVM VPS 提供服务。
我们认为:软件应可免费取得,软件工具在各种语言环境下皆可使用,且不会有任何功能上的差异;
人们应有定制和修改软件的自由,且方式不受限制,只要他们自认为合适。

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
简体中文语系由 王笑宇 翻译